An overview of this role

As a Senior Product Manager, you’ll own the strategy, roadmap, and adoption of GitLab Dedicated (Commercial), GitLab’s single-tenant SaaS deployment of our Enterprise DevSecOps Platform for highly regulated and security-conscious customers. You’ll define how we evolve Dedicated into a scalable, reliable, and secure platform, balancing customer needs, technical capabilities, and business outcomes while partnering closely with Engineering, Operations, Sales, Finance, and go-to-market teams. You’ll focus on driving enterprise adoption, shaping pricing and packaging, and ensuring the service meets strict security, compliance, and performance expectations, so customers can run GitLab with confidence in their own isolated environments.

Some examples of our projects:

  • Evolving the GitLab Dedicated architecture to improve automation, reusability, and extensibility across tenants

  • Refining pricing and packaging for Dedicated based on customer value, usage patterns, and market feedback

What you’ll do

  • Define and drive the product strategy and roadmap for GitLab Dedicated (Commercial), focusing on delivering customer results and growing the platform.

  • Collaborate with Engineering and Operations to build an automated, reusable, and extensible single-tenant SaaS foundation that is reliable, secure, and performant at scale.

  • Balance feature development with operational excellence and platform stability when prioritizing the roadmap.

  • Partner with Sales, Professional Services, Support, Finance, and other go-to-market teams to drive adoption, forecast outcomes, and scale GitLab Dedicated across enterprise customer segments.

  • Refine pricing and packaging for GitLab Dedicated based on customer value, market dynamics, and business performance.

  • Engage directly with enterprise customers, especially in highly regulated industries, to understand requirements, address security and compliance needs, and translate feedback into actionable product iterations.

  • Define clear success metrics, analyze product and business data, and use insights to validate decisions and measure impact.

  • Collaborate with Product Marketing to create and maintain positioning, messaging, and enablement materials that help customer-facing teams articulate the value and differentiation of GitLab Dedicated.

What you’ll bring

  • Product management experience building and shipping successful SaaS products, from discovery and roadmap definition through launch and iteration.

  • Practical understanding of running a SaaS service at scale, including operations, reliability, scalability, and tradeoffs between new features and stability.

  • Ability to work effectively across distributed, cross-functional, multi-time-zone teams (engineering, finance, sales, marketing, support, professional services) and through ambiguity.

  • Strong communication skills with the ability to translate complex, often technical, customer and regulatory requirements into clear product plans and iterations.

  • Experience engaging directly with enterprise customers in highly regulated industries, including understanding of security, compliance, and data protection needs.

  • Comfortable using data and analytics to inform decisions, define success metrics, and measure the impact of product changes.

  • Demonstrated ability to balance technical depth with business acumen, including experience with pricing, packaging, and business case development.

About the team

As part of the GitLab Dedicated team, you’ll work with product managers, engineers, operations specialists, and go-to-market partners who are focused on delivering secure, reliable, single-tenant SaaS instances of GitLab for enterprise customers in regulated industries. The team owns the GitLab Dedicated (Commercial) service within the broader GitLab platform, and collaborates asynchronously across time zones, relying on written communication and clear documentation to stay aligned. You’ll join a group that is scaling Dedicated in a sustainable way while solving the challenges of operating enterprise-grade, single-tenant DevSecOps at scale, including security, compliance, and performance expectations.
